The auto drain timer can be set both for the frequency of operation, and for the length of time that the auto drain valve is opened, to effectively and automatically rid the compressor tank of water that is generated by the compressing of air. When searching for the right auto drain valve for your air compressor there are a few considerations Other than considering the different types of auto drain valves, whether that be a timed one or a float one. Most air compressor auto tank drain valves will meet both these ranges, with the setup of the valve opening for 3 seconds every 30 to 45 minutes being the most popular across compressed air systems.

Do you need to drain air compressor every time?

Even if your air compressor’s pump cycles only a handful of times per day, you should drain your compressor tank every other day or several times per week to prolong its operating life and to protect your pneumatic devices and equipment.

Is it OK to leave an air compressor pressurized?

Leaving an air compressor pressurized does not have any immediate bad effects. Most compressors are designed to tolerate pressurization for a day or two without the tank suffering a catastrophic failure. Doing so has a major drawback. A continuously pressurized tank will weaken its seal.

How often should you drain water from air compressor?

It is recommended that you drain your tank daily, whether it is manually or automatically. Water build up in your tank can cause the bottom of your tank to rust forcing you to invest in a new tank. What happens if air compressor is not drained?

When air compressors run humidity in the air they compress condenses in the tank. The resulting water sits in the bottom of the tank until it is drained. When not drained regularly the tank will rust from the inside out, when the tank is weakened enough it will often fail catastrophically.

Should drain valve be closed on air compressor?

If unit will not be used for a while, it is best to leave drain valve open until such time as it is to be used. This will allow moisture to completely drain out and help prevent corrosion on the inside of tank.

Which air tank drains first?

When draining the tanks, the supply tank should always be drained first to prevent accumulated moisture flowing into the next tank being drained. When the supply tank is drained first, any accumulated moisture is removed before it can pass further into the system.

Why must air tanks be drained?

Explanation Compressed air in an air brake system usually contains a certain amount of water and compressor oil. The water and oil can damage the brakes if left to accumulate in the system. Tanks must be drained regularly to remove this build-up.

What is an auto drain?

An Automatic drain is a 2/2 valve which closes when the system is pressurised. The Drain opens when liquid accumulates and causes the float to rise, and on depressurisation.
